
British video games refer to video games that are developed, published, or significantly influenced by creators or studios based in the United Kingdom. The UK has a rich history in the gaming industry, producing iconic titles and franchises such as Tomb Raider, Grand Theft Auto, and Fable. British video games are known for their innovation, distinctive humor, and creative storytelling, contributing significantly to global gaming culture and technological advancements.
